Kind of sun allergy on hand
I'hve been having white patches on the anterior side of my forearm nearby wrist area since a month ago as in june i had encountered for 2-3 hours to direct sunlight on my hand And now whenever i step out in daylight with high temperature and the time sun rays strikes my hand it starts irritating kind of itching sensations.

You could be probably suffering from PMLE , which is kind of Sun allergy . Always wear broad spectrum sunscreen while going out .reapply it every 4 hours. Cover your exposed skin with gloves, full sleeved clothes. An actual examination of the affected skin and clinical history will be helpful in arriving at an proper diagnosis and for advising treatment. Dr Arti Bhasme, Pune
